Jean Marburg League of Women Voters collection, 1970/1988

13.25 Linear Feet 26 boxes
Abstract Or Scope
Materials relate to the daily operations and special projects of the League of Women Voters of the Fairfax Area (LWVFA), particularly 1979-1984 when Jean Marburg served on the Executive Board. Materials are representative of LWVFA's focus on many community, social, environmental, and political issues such as nuclear energy, hunger, defense, international development, and trade. Types of materials include reports, correspondence, printed materials, and notes.

Noman M. Cole, Jr. papers

19 Linear Feet 39 boxes
Abstract Or Scope
This collection covers his environmental work (particularly in the area of water pollution control and reclamation) in Northern Virginia and other areas in the Commonwealth. Materials include reports on the design, operation, and performance of pollution control systems; correspondence; studies; news clippings; and motion picture film. Organizations in the collection include: Virginia Department of Environmental Quality, Virginia State Water Control Board, Metropolitan Council of Governments, and Fairfax County Government.
